A wrap-around can wrap which is secured together by primary and secondary locks with a single aperture securing both a primary and secondary lock, with each secondary lock being attached to a bottom flap of the carrier through a locking base. The locking base on each end of the carrier having a shoulder to secure the secondary lock, with the locking base for each secondary lock being reduced in length due to the presence of the locking shoulders. This carrier has open ends with the width of the carrier being such that cylindrical containers in the carrier project beyond the ends of the side panels of the carrier and are secured in place by a retaining flap that extends around a portion of the container that extends beyond the end of the side panel of the carrier from the top of the container to the adjacent side panel of the carrier, thereby permitting the width of the carrier to be significantly less than the width of a conventional open ended carrier.

What is claimed is: 1. A locked wrap-around carrier having a length around the carrier and width with open ends containing a plurality of cylindrical containers each with a diameter in two rows comprising: a. a top panel which is foldably interconnected to two side panels, one side panel being foldably connected to a first bottom flap and the other side said panel being foldably interconnected to a second bottom flap; b. said first bottom flap having a plurality of primary male locks formed by slit cuts interconnected by fold lines in said first bottom flap, and having a plurality of locking bases formed as an extension of said flap with a secondary male lock formed as an extension of each locking base, with the locking base adjacent each end of the carrier having a locking shoulder extending from said adjacent locking base to the adjacent end of the carrier to aid in securing said locks in the locked position; c. said second bottom flap having a plurality of female openings, with each such opening having a primary female locking ledge against which a primary male lock is secured and having a secondary female locking ledge against which a secondary male lock is secured; d. said carrier having a tuck-in flap foldably attached to each side panel at each end of the carrier with each flap having a top and bottom with a retaining flap foldably attached to the top of each tuck-in flap and foldably attached to the top panel, and a retaining flap foldably attached to the bottom of each tuck-in flap and an adjacent bottom flap; and e. with the width of the side panels of the carrier being significantly less than the sum of the diameters of the containers in each row with all of said containers on each end of the carrier extending a significant distance beyond the adjacent side panel, said containers being prevented from falling out of the carrier by each tuck-in flap being wedged between an adjacent container and an adjacent side panel so as to hold the retaining flap on each end of the tuck-in panel securely against an adjacent can, each said retaining flap extending from an end of said container in a diagonal arc across a portion of the side of said container that projects beyond said end of said adjacent side panel of the carrier to an adjacent side panel. 2. The carrier of claim 1 in which there is an aperture between each retaining flap and the adjacent side panel to facilitate folding, and holding said retaining flap in a diagonal arc position across a portion of the side of said adjacent container. 3. The carrier of claim 1 in which the length of each locking base and each attached secondary locking male lock is significantly less than the length of the locking base and attached secondary male lock that extends from the end of a bottom flap of a carrier with a conventional secondary male lock due to the presence of locking shoulders between the locking base adjacent each end of the carrier and the end of the carrier which aids in holding all of the locks securely locked and the use of a single female opening for locking both a primary and secondary male lock thereby reducing the length of the carrier. 4.
